向 Excel 的 FIX: 错误消息,当您试图导出 SQL Server 2005 报告:"索引超出范围"

BUG #: 342 (SQL 修补程序)
Microsoft 将 Microsoft SQL Server 2005 修补程序分发作为一个可下载的文件。因为该修补程序是累积性的因此每个新版本包含的所有修补程序和所有安全修补程序附带以前 SQL Server 2005 修补都程序版本。
本文介绍以下有关此修补程序版本:
  • 通过此修补程序包修复的问题
  • 安装此修补程序包的先决条件
  • 在应用此修补程序包后是否必须重新启动计算机
  • 此修补程序包是否替换任何其他修补程序包
  • 是否必须应用此修补程序包后进行任何注册表的更改
  • 此修补程序包中包含的文件

症状
当试图将 SQL Server 2005 报表导出到 Microsoft Office Excel 或 Microsoft Excel 时,您可能会收到类似于以...

当试图将 SQL Server 2005 报表导出到 Microsoft Office Excel 或 Microsoft Excel 时,您可能会收到类似于以下内容的错误消息:
索引超出范围。必须是非负数且小于集合的大小。参数名称: 索引

原因
在下面的情况下,就会发生此问题: 在多个嵌套容器中嵌入了报表项。报表项的一些示例如下所示: 表矩阵列表图表文本框图像行矩形子报表在报表中显示数据和图形元素的任何...

在下面的情况下,就会发生此问题:
  • 在多个嵌套容器中嵌入了报表项。报表项的一些示例如下所示:
    • 矩阵
    • 列表
    • 图表
    • 文本框
    • 图像
    • 矩形
    • 子报表
    • 在报表中显示数据和图形元素的任何其他项目。
  • 嵌入的报表项是隐藏的。其 可见性 属性设置为FALSE,可以隐藏了报表项。此外可以以编程方式隐藏了报表项。
  • 时隐藏的嵌入的报表项 Excel 报告呈现器中删除该项目的用户界面空间。Excel 报告呈现器删除的隐藏项在用户界面空间使用收缩 算法。
  • Excel 报告呈现器使用索引来跟踪报告中的项的总数量。应用此修补程序之前,嵌入的报表项不会包括在报告中的项的总数量。
  • 当 Excel 报告呈现器试图通过索引号来查找嵌入的报表项时,嵌入的报表项的索引号大于报告中的项的总数量。因此,Excel 报告呈现器引发索引超出范围 错误。

解决方案
若要解决此问题,获得最新的 service pack,SQL Server 2005 年。有关详细的信息请单击下面的文章编号,以查看 Microsoft 知识库...

若要解决此问题,获得最新的 service pack,SQL Server 2005 年。有关详细的信息请单击下面的文章编号,以查看 Microsoft 知识库中相应的文章:
913090 (http://support.microsoft.com/kb/913090/ ) 已修复 SQL Server 2005 Service Pack 1 中的 bug 的列表
Microsoft 已经确认这是在"适用于"一节中列出的 Microsoft 产品中的问题。 此问题 SQL Server 2005 Service Pack...
Microsoft 已经确认这是在"适用于"一节中列出的 Microsoft 产品中的问题。 此问题 SQL Server 2005 Service Pack 服务包 1年中第一次已得到纠正。

910375 (http://support.microsoft.com/kb/910375/ ) FIX: 當您使用 SQL Server 2005 報表服務資訊匯出到 Excel 時,沒有資料表標頭出現在 Excel 報表中
910376 (http://support.microsoft.com/kb/910376/ ) FIX: 您可能會意外地收到一個零或 null 的傳回值當您在 SQL Server 2005 分析服務 」 中的關聯式 OLAP 資料分割上執行 MDX 查詢時
910414 (http://support.microsoft.com/kb/910414/ ) FIX: 您可能會收到錯誤訊息,當您嘗試藉由 CLR 功能在 SQL Server 2005 中的 Transact-SQL 工作中載入資料
910416 (http://support.microsoft.com/kb/910416/ ) FIX: 當您執行某些查詢或特定的錯誤訊息中預存程序 SQL Server 2005: 「 上目前的命令發生 A 嚴重錯誤 」
910418 (http://support.microsoft.com/kb/910418/ ) FIX: 您可能會收到錯誤訊息,當您嘗試使用未使用 CustomData 屬性的 ADO 連接字串連線至 SQL Server 2005 分析服務
911912 (http://support.microsoft.com/kb/911912/ ) FIX: 您低 CPU 尖峰於設定的間隔甚至時遇到在 SQL Server 2005 中沒有任何使用者活動
911937 (http://support.microsoft.com/kb/911937/ ) FIX: 指示識別資料行,在來源資料庫中的結構描述將無法轉移到目的資料庫當您嘗試在 SQL Server 2005 中使用 SQL 管理物件到目的資料庫傳送物件從來源資料庫
912001 (http://support.microsoft.com/kb/912001/ ) 當您設計彙總設計精靈 」,在 [SQL Server 2005 分析服務的彙總 FIX: 錯誤訊息: 「 發生未預期的例外狀況的內部錯誤 」
912016 (http://support.microsoft.com/kb/912016/ ) FIX: 錯誤訊息時處理所使用處理選項] 或 [預設處理作業] 處理選項,在 [SQL Server 2005 分析服務的處理程序更新的維度: 「 已取消作業"
912017 (http://support.microsoft.com/kb/912017/ ) 當您連線到 SQL Server 2005 分析服務的執行個體 FIX: 錯誤訊息: 「 無法建立的連線。確定伺服器正在執行"。
912021 (http://support.microsoft.com/kb/912021/ ) FIX: 您可能會收到錯誤訊息,當您嘗試使用備份軟體,在 SQL Server 2005 中將資料庫備份的 Itanium 系統
912136 (http://support.microsoft.com/kb/912136/ ) 執行商務智慧精靈在 SQL Server 2005 分析服務中加入時間計算之後,可能會遇到問題
912322 (http://support.microsoft.com/kb/912322/ ) FIX: 讀取大量資料的應用程式查詢可能會很慢,而且 SQL Server 服務可能要花很長的時間在 SQL Server 2005 中啟動
912419 (http://support.microsoft.com/kb/912419/ ) FIX: 屬性的屬性階層仍會顯示當您瀏覽 Cube,即使 AttributeHierarchyVisible 屬性之屬性的值設定為 False,在 [SQL Server 2005 分析服務
912422 (http://support.microsoft.com/kb/912422/ ) FIX: 的同步的資料庫鏡像工作階段狀態可能會中斷連接時仍維持您設定同步的資料庫鏡像,但不要設定見證資料庫並在 SQL Server 2005 中執行 DBCC STACKDUMP 命令
912423 (http://support.microsoft.com/kb/912423/ ) FIX: 記憶體遺漏 (Memory Leak) 當您使用就會發生模糊查閱和模糊群組轉換 SQL Server 2005 整合服務套件
912429 (http://support.microsoft.com/kb/912429/ ) 當從 SQL Server 2005 分析服務資料庫執行查詢資料的 MDX 陳述式 FIX: 錯誤訊息: 「 發生未預期的例外狀況的內部錯誤 」
912439 (http://support.microsoft.com/kb/912439/ ) 當您嘗試在 SQL Server 2005 中相同的時間,在大型資料集上執行幾個查詢 FIX: 錯誤訊息: 「 701 有是系統記憶體不足,無法執行這項查詢 」
912446 (http://support.microsoft.com/kb/912446/ ) FIX: 您會收到不正確的結果當您執行探索要求或呼叫 AdomdConnection.GetSchemaDataSet 方法對 SQL Server 2005 分析服務伺服器
912450 (http://support.microsoft.com/kb/912450/ ) FIX: 您可能會收到 null 值的導出成員在 SQL Server 2005 分析服務中執行 MDX 查詢時
912459 (http://support.microsoft.com/kb/912459/ ) FIX: 錯誤訊息時使用 HTTP 通訊協定查詢 SQL Server 2005 分析服務資料庫中的資料:"Xml Parsing 失敗"
912471 (http://support.microsoft.com/kb/912471/ ) FIX: 在伺服器上的複寫仍無法解決問題再當您以手動方式錯誤後移轉在 SQL Server 2005 中的資料庫
912472 (http://support.microsoft.com/kb/912472/ ) FIX: 不正確的結果可能會出現在訂閱資料庫當您設定資料庫鏡像的資料庫,而且在 SQL Server 2005 中發生資料庫錯誤後移轉
912702 (http://support.microsoft.com/kb/912702/ ) 在 [SQL Server 2005 分析服務執行 MDX 查詢時,FIX: 錯誤訊息: 「 維度找不到屬性"
912705 (http://support.microsoft.com/kb/912705/ ) 當您嘗試鑽研 SQL Server 2005 報表服務中的某一報表 FIX: 錯誤訊息: 「 報表伺服器上發生一個內部錯誤。請參閱錯誤記錄檔,以取得更多詳細資料 」
912885 (http://support.microsoft.com/kb/912885/ ) FIX: 您可能會收到存取違規錯誤訊息,當您在 SQL Server 2005 中執行平行執行計劃
913363 (http://support.microsoft.com/kb/913363/ ) FIX: 您收到錯誤訊息當您使用 SQL Server 2005 報表服務來執行報表中有兩個或多個參數
913371 (http://support.microsoft.com/kb/913371/ ) FIX: 您可能會收到錯誤訊息,當您使用 sp_cursoropen 陳述式來開啟 SQL Server 2005 中的使用者定義的預存程序上的資料指標
913849 (http://support.microsoft.com/kb/913849/ ) FIX: 當您執行的 MDX 時,就會傳回沒有任何結果集 unnatural 階層會使用 SQL Server 2005 中的查詢
913854 (http://support.microsoft.com/kb/913854/ ) 當您嘗試切換至類神經網路採擷模型,在 [SQL Server 2005 分析服務時,收到錯誤訊息
913941 (http://support.microsoft.com/kb/913941/ ) FIX: SQL Server 的登入可能有更多的權限登入 SQL Server 2005 的執行個體時
914019 (http://support.microsoft.com/kb/914019/ ) FIX: 您在 SQL Server 2005 中使用 SQLdiag 公用程式時,可能發生問題
914233 (http://support.microsoft.com/kb/914233/ ) FIX: SQL Server 2005 分析服務可能會意外關閉當您建立,然後在相同的工作階段中刪除某個 Subcube
914535 (http://support.microsoft.com/kb/914535/ ) 注意: 當您使用 ActiveX 資料物件資料錄集物件來存取 SQL Server 2005 中的資料庫時,資料錄集物件傳回沒有記錄
914595 (http://support.microsoft.com/kb/914595/ ) FIX: 維度處理可能會失敗,而且可能會收到錯誤訊息在 SQL Server 2005 分析服務
914596 (http://support.microsoft.com/kb/914596/ ) 當對包含等位的項目,在 SQL Server 2005 中的 XML 資料執行 XQuery 時,就會傳回等位項不正確的型別
914638 (http://support.microsoft.com/kb/914638/ ) 當您使用 XQuery 擷取的 XML 項目 SQL Server 2005 中的值時,您會收到 NULL 值
914640 (http://support.microsoft.com/kb/914640/ ) 當您嘗試將字串轉換成 SQL Server 2005 中的 XML 資料型別時,出現錯誤訊息: 「 無法繫結至保留的命名空間 」
914779 (http://support.microsoft.com/kb/914779/ ) 當您在 SQL Server 2005 中使用 「 設定散發精靈 」 時,可能會收到錯誤訊息
914780 (http://support.microsoft.com/kb/914780/ ) 當您嘗試使用您在 SQL Server 2005 中建立合併式發行集時,出現錯誤訊息: 「 無法使用 Precomputed 磁碟分割 」
914781 (http://support.microsoft.com/kb/914781/ ) 當您嘗試在 SQL Server Express 中建立新的訂閱時,出現錯誤訊息: 「 無效的資料行名稱 'step_uid' 」。
915047 (http://support.microsoft.com/kb/915047/ ) 當想執行 SQL Server 管理 Studio 中的查詢編輯器中的查詢在不同的查詢編輯器中的查詢會改執行
915050 (http://support.microsoft.com/kb/915050/ ) 當您使用 sys.dm_exec_query_plan 動態管理函數來傳回一個顯示計劃中 T-SQL 批次的 XML 格式時,出現錯誤訊息: 「 A 系統判斷提示檢查失敗"
915693 (http://support.microsoft.com/kb/915693/ ) 新的結構描述中 Msmd.h 檔案不包含在 SQL Server 2005 分析服務中的資料列集的 GUID
915698 (http://support.microsoft.com/kb/915698/ ) 當您變更 SQL Server 服務帳號叢集的執行個體的 SQL Server 2005 時,出現錯誤訊息: 「 系統找不到指定的檔案"
915763 (http://support.microsoft.com/kb/915763/ ) FIX: 稽核結構描述物件存取事件的權限資料行不會顯示在 SQL Server 2005 中
915793 (http://support.microsoft.com/kb/915793/ ) FIX: 您無法還原記錄檔備份鏡像伺服器上的之後移除資料庫鏡像資料庫,SQL Server 2005 中的鏡像
915845 (http://support.microsoft.com/kb/915845/ ) SQL Server 代理程式作業失敗時工作包含安裝 SQL Server 2005 Service Pack 1 之後,使用語彙基元 (Token) 的作業步驟
916086 (http://support.microsoft.com/kb/916086/ ) FIX: 錯誤可能會產生 tempdb 資料庫中當您建立並再在 SQL Server 2005 中卸除多暫存資料表

你可能感兴趣的:(sql server 2005)